Uniaxial compression influence on electroluminescence spectra in p-Al x Ga1−x As/GaAs1−y P y /n-Al x Ga1−x As heterostructures
2008
We present new results on the influence of uniaxial stress up to P=400 MPa along [110] direction on the electroluminescence (EL) spectra of p-Al x Ga1−x As/GaAs1−y P y /n-Al x Ga1−x As double heterostructures. With increasing stress, the emission spectra demonstrate a blue shift of up to 20 meV at a pressure of P=400 MPa, while the EL intensity increases under compression. The results are discussed in terms of changes in the band structure under uniaxial compression.
